I also have been involved at work and as a HAM with
some of the recent, 21 Dec. 2006, deployed satellites
from the Shuttle, STS-116.  I was able to get some
spin rate info to WB4APR (Bob) with in minutes of
release of RAFT/NMARS.  He was concerned with possible
retarded antenna deployments with the torques from the
high spin rates.

The objects of interest to me especially at work are
the ANDE release (5 components).  The two calibration
spheres (MAA and FCal) will be used for determining
atomic neutral densities in the thermosphere for
improving satellite drag models.  MAA was stuck in its
cylinder initially but has apprently extricated itself
and all 5 are now flying independently.
